WWE Superstar Omos has donated to Luke Menzies' GoFundMe after his sudden departure from the company. Menzies worked as Ridge Holland from 2019 to 2025.Holland signed with the WWE in 2018 and debuted at an NXT live event. In 2019, he made his televised debut for the NXT UK brand under his new in-ring name, defeating Oliver Carter.On October 13th, Holland announced that WWE wouldn't renew his contract upon expiration, marking the end of his 7-year tenure with them. In a controversial move from the company, they opted to terminate his contract earlier than it was supposed to be.A GoFundMe was started for the 37-year-old star to help him survive the period without pay. Multiple superstars, including Chelsea Green, Jinder Mahal, and AEW's Kyle Fletcher, have donated. Current WWE Superstar Omos has also donated $1,000 to his former colleague.Omos opened up about working with Oba FemiOmos and Oba Femi shared the ring during an NXT live event.
